While I was in California I went to see some of the Chumash rock art at the Painted Caves in Santa Barbara. Most of the art was behind bars to prevent any damage, but after climbing the wall to investigate I managed to find this further up & out of sight.Considering it was over the entrance to the cave, I assume it is meant to act as a guardian throughout the night.
